When you have a new toilet ready to go but aren't comfortable with the seal or the water connection, you need a pro. A plumber ensures the wax ring is set perfectly to prevent odors and leaks, and that the water supply is properly tightened. You need this if you want to avoid water damage or a wobbly base. High summer temperatures mean your plumbing works harder than ever. Increased water usage for lawn care and cooling systems can strain your pipes and disposal units.
